The brief

The Arizona Cardinals began their training camp on Wednesday. Current reporting focuses on the team's composition as they enter the new season, with specific attention given to the cornerback outlook.

Coverage from Arizona Sports and Fox News emphasizes a deficit of elite talent, with Fox News describing the team as arguably the most depressing in the NFL. Yahoo Sports and the official Arizona Cardinals channels have released the full roster and addressed key questions facing the team.

Observers will monitor how the team addresses these talent gaps and resolves the top questions identified by the organization as training camp progresses.
